Precision Cleaning with Minimal Particle Generation
Foam swabs are widely used in critical cleaning and sampling applications due to their low-lint properties and controlled absorbency. Constructed from open-cell polyurethane foam, these swabs provide excellent solvent retention and release while minimizing particle generation.
Unlike fiber-based swabs, foam structures do not shed, making them ideal for cleanroom and sensitive electronic applications where contamination must be tightly controlled.
They are commonly used across semiconductor manufacturing, electronics assembly, pharmaceutical environments, and precision laboratory workflows.

Common Foam Swab Issues to Avoid
- Over-saturating swabs leading to solvent pooling.
- Using incorrect size or tip shape for the application.
- Applying excessive pressure on delicate surfaces.
- Using non-cleanroom foam in controlled environments.
- Ignoring compatibility with aggressive solvents.
- Improper storage leading to contamination.
